Are do you have experience in auditing, compliance within Adult Social Care. We are looking for a Compliance Officer to join our expanding team at Oakfield Community. The role is 22.5hrs a week (3 days) working across both provisions at Yardley Hastings and Easton Maudit (East Northants)Monday, Wednesday, Friday but negotiable for the days.
Hours - 9am - 4.30pm
Overall purpose of the post
To:
- Audits ensure that the required audits are completed on a monthly basis, with any actions highlighted recorded on the home development plans. Monitor actions, check completed and sign off, this is at both sites.
- Care plans
- Audit and monitor care plans to ensure that they are person centred, liaising with relevant member of staff, if any changes required.
- Support the Deputies in each home with all compliance, as and when required.
- Support the Charity Manager/Registered Manager as and when required.
- Demonstrate awareness and understanding of equal opportunities and other people's behavioural, physical, social and welfare needs.
- Ensure that reasonable care is always taken for the health, safety and welfare of yourself and other persons, and to comply with the legislation, policies and procedures relating to health and safety, staff training and supervision within the organisation.
- Carry out any other duties which fall within the broad spirit, scope, and purpose of this job description and which are commensurate with the skills level of the post.
